Clinical Pharmacist careers

For those considering a career as a Clinical Pharmacist, Tasmania offers a range of comprehensive Clinical Pharmacist courses designed for experienced learners. With five advanced courses available, including the Graduate Diploma of Advanced Pharmacy Practice and the Master of Clinical Pharmacy, you can deepen your knowledge and skills in this vital healthcare sector. The courses are delivered by respected institutions, such as the Pharmaceutical Society of Australia and the University of Tasmania, ensuring you receive quality education in alignment with industry standards.

In Tasmania, aspiring Clinical Pharmacists can pursue qualifications that align with their career goals and previous experience. Among the options is the Graduate Certificate in Clinical Pharmacy, which provides foundational expertise for those looking to specialise in clinical roles. Each of these courses is crafted to equip students with the essential skills needed to thrive in the healthcare landscape, making this an excellent time to explore the Clinical Pharmacist courses in Tasmania.

Completing a Clinical Pharmacist course can open doors to various relevant job roles. Graduates may find exciting career opportunities as a Pharmacist, Pharmacy Technician, or even a Clinical Research Coordinator. Related positions such as Pharmaceutical Scientist and Pharmaceutical Sales Representative are also viable paths for those with a strong background in pharmacy. Each role is intrinsically linked to the ongoing need for skilled professionals in Tasmania’s healthcare system.
